(Chicago, IL) — After one prominent Illinois Republican called on U.S. Senator Mark Kirk to drop plans to seek reelection, other big names in the GOP are rallying behind him. Fundraiser Ron Gidwitz says Kirk’s recent verbal gaffes make him unelectable, but former governor Jim Edgar says Kirk can survive once he demonstrates his stroke doesn’t prevent him from carrying out his duties. Congressman Peter Roskam also issued a statement of support, and other members of the Illinois delegation have reportedly turned down inquiries about challenging Kirk in a primary.
